For Employers
Ref:71237
Methods & Systems Lead
DohaLocation
Doha
7 hours ago
Posted date
7 hours ago
SeniorMinimum level
Senior
null
EA Personal Registration No.
null

Qualifications & Experience Required

Educational Requirement:

  • Bachelor's degree in IT or a related field, with a preference for a Master’s degree in IT authorizations or an equivalent qualification.

Required Experience:

  • 10-15 years of expertise in the relevant field.
  • Knowledge of system authorizations, including authorization setup for related platforms.
  • Familiarity with Segregation of Duties (SOD) concepts.
  • Experience with risk & compliance tools (e.g., Governance, Risk, and Compliance systems) is a plus.
  • Critical thinking and problem-solving mindset.
  • Ability to work independently and take initiative.
  • Strong ability to self-manage, make decisions, and continuously improve both business and technical knowledge.

Communication Skills:

  • Ability to build and maintain relationships with business and technical stakeholders across multiple affiliates.
  • Professional and diplomatic communication style.
  • Fluent in English.

Based in Qatar/Korea

Related tags
JOB SUMMARY
Methods & Systems Lead
Doha
7 hours ago
Senior
Full-time